10/42 Meeks St, Kingsford is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1963. The property has a land size of 76m2 and floor size of 71m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in March 2021.

The size of Kingsford is approximately 2.0 square kilometres. There are 9 parks, covering nearly 0.5% of the total area. The population of Kingsford in 2016 was 15482 people. By 2021 the population was 13492 showing a population decline of 12.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kingsford is 20-29 years. Households in Kingsford are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kingsford work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 46.20% of the homes in Kingsford were owner-occupied compared with 43.00% in 2016.
